I visited Fort Pillow a year ago. The Confederate dead, as I recall, are buried in a sizable burial ground along side the entrance road to the Park. The Fort Pillow State Historic Park has a rather nice museum which covers both the 1862 and 1864 periods. Contact information can be found at their website: http://www.state.tn.us/environment/parks/FortPillow/index.shtml

They should have a listing of known dead.
